Tsutomu Kurisaki is a scholar working on Materials Chemistry, Inorganic Chemistry and Oncology. According to data from OpenAlex, Tsutomu Kurisaki has authored 43 papers receiving a total of 465 indexed citations (citations by other indexed papers that have themselves been cited), including 15 papers in Materials Chemistry, 15 papers in Inorganic Chemistry and 9 papers in Oncology. Recurrent topics in Tsutomu Kurisaki’s work include Metal complexes synthesis and properties (9 papers), TiO2 Photocatalysis and Solar Cells (7 papers) and X-ray Spectroscopy and Fluorescence Analysis (7 papers). Tsutomu Kurisaki is often cited by papers focused on Metal complexes synthesis and properties (9 papers), TiO2 Photocatalysis and Solar Cells (7 papers) and X-ray Spectroscopy and Fluorescence Analysis (7 papers). Tsutomu Kurisaki collaborates with scholars based in Japan, Italy and United States. Tsutomu Kurisaki's co-authors include Hisanobu Wakita, Takushi Yokoyama, Shuji Matsuo, H. Wakita, Bunsho Ohtani, Hisao Yamashige, Hikaru Abe, R. C. C. Perera, Manabu Fujiwara and Toshio Yamaguchi and has published in prestigious journals such as The Journal of Physical Chemistry B, Applied Catalysis B Environment and Energy and Journal of Colloid and Interface Science.
